Pick Inkling if you want the stronger benchmark profile. Composer 2 only becomes the better choice if you want the cheaper token bill or you want the stronger reasoning-first profile.
Confidence note. This is a partial-evidence comparison with 2 shared benchmark results across 2 evidence categories; 2 of 8 categories currently have scoreable aggregates for both models. Treat the verdict as directional until coverage is more balanced.
Why this result
Inkling is clearly ahead on the provisional aggregate, 69 to 61. The gap is large enough that you do not need to squint at the spreadsheet to see the difference.
Inkling's sharpest advantage is in coding, where it averages 68.6 against 58. The single biggest benchmark swing on the page is Terminal-Bench 2.0, 61.7% to 63.8%.
Inkling is also the more expensive model on tokens at $1.87 input / $4.68 output per 1M tokens, versus $0.50 input / $2.50 output per 1M tokens for Composer 2. Composer 2 is the reasoning model in the pair, while Inkling is not. That usually helps on harder chain-of-thought-heavy tests, but it can also mean more latency and more token spend in real use. Inkling gives you the larger context window at 1M, compared with 200K for Composer 2.
